Cure for ADHD in Adults: Understanding, Managing, and Living with Attention Deficit Hyperactivity DisorderAttention Deficit Disorder (ADHD) is typically associated with children; however, lots of grownups continue to experience its effects. This condition can profoundly impact different elements of life, consisting of profession, relationships, and personal well-being. Understanding ADHD, exploring reliable management techniques, and addressing typical misconceptions are vital steps toward leading a fulfilling life for those affected.Understanding ADHD in AdultsADHD is identified by relentless patterns of inattention and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ity that disrupt operating or advancement. Below is a table summing up typical symptoms of ADHD in adults.Symptoms of ADHD in AdultsDescriptionNegligenceTrouble focusing, forgetfulness, disorganization, and distractibility.HyperactivityExcessive talking, uneasyness, and a consistent sense of being "on the go."ImpulsivityProblem waiting in lines, interrupting others, and making rash decisions.Emotional DysregulationMood swings, frustration tolerance, and problem handling tension.Low MotivationObstacles in setting and attaining individual objectives.Medical diagnosis and AssessmentGetting a correct diagnosis is important for grownups who believe they have ADHD. A detailed examination normally includes:Clinical Interview: A psychological health expert gathers details about the individual's history, symptoms, and practical impairments.Self-Reported Questionnaires: Standardized tools such as the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) might be used.Behavioral Assessments: Input from household, friends, or associates can supply valuable insight into the individual's performance.Treatment OptionsWhile there is no conclusive "treatment" for ADHD, lots of effective treatments can assist manage symptoms and improve lifestyle. Treatment can consist of medication, therapy, and way of life modifications. Here's a breakdown of typical methods:Treatment OptionsDescriptionMedicationStimulant medications (like Adderall) and non-stimulant alternatives (like Strattera) can assist enhance focus and minimize impulsivity.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)CBT works in helping adults with ADHD develop coping strategies and restructure unfavorable thought patterns.CoachingADHD coaches can help people with company, time management, and goal-setting.Support systemGetting in touch with others who share similar experiences can offer psychological support and useful suggestions.Way of life ChangesRegular workout, a healthy diet plan, sufficient sleep, and mindfulness practices such as meditation can significantly benefit ADHD symptoms.Table: Effectiveness of Treatment OptionsTreatment OptionEfficiencyFactors to considerMedicationHighMight have side results; needs medical guidance.CBTModerate to HighTime-intensive; might need numerous sessions.CoachingModerateRequires motivation; varies depending on the coach.Assistance GroupsModeratePeer-led; benefits differ based upon individual engagement.Lifestyle ChangesVariableMay take time to see outcomes; highly individualistic.Way Of Life Modifications to ConsiderFor numerous adults, embracing particular way of life modifications can help handle ADHD signs effectively. Here are some suggestions:Establish Routines: Develop a day-to-day schedule to promote consistency and reduce lapse of memory.Set Clear Goals: Break larger jobs into smaller sized, workable actions and set deadlines to help keep focus and inspiration.Lessen Distractions: Create a devoted office and decrease environmental distractions to enhance concentration.Practice Mindfulness: Engage in mindfulness practices, such as meditation or yoga, to improve focus and minimize tension.Exercise Regularly: Physical activity can help in reducing hyperactivity and enhance state of mind, promoting overall well-being.Frequently asked questions About ADHD in AdultsQ1: Can ADHD be diagnosed in adulthood?Yes, ADHD can bedetected in their adult years. Many individuals are unaware they have it till later in life, often when they deal with difficulties in work or relationships. Q2: What is the most effective treatment foradult ADHD?The most efficient treatment differs by individual; nevertheless, a mix of medication and cognitive behavioral therapy(CBT)has shown appealing outcomes for many adults. Q3: Are there any natural remedies for ADHD?While there are no clinically proven natural remedies, some people find that dietary changes, routine workout, and meditation help handle signs. Q4: How can I support a loved one with ADHD?Support can include being patient, helping them organize jobs, motivating treatment, and advocating for their needs in social and professional settings. Q5: Is there a link between ADHD and other psychological health disorders?Yes, grownups with ADHD might be most likely to experience other conditions such as anxiety, depression, and substance utilize conditions.
